Transaction 22c2284efd98bd02a3560a24f584d2a9c2cbb13e6f85138cbde668c83f311d8a
1 Input
1 Output
-
22c2284efd98bd02a3560a24f584d2a9c2cbb13e6f85138cbde668c83f311d8a:0
- value
- 553694
- script pubkey
- OP_0 OP_PUSHBYTES_20 babf5635341a2df7c51d32ac213bb66b36f3e5d1
- address
- bc1qh2l4vdf5rgkl03gax2kzzwakdvm08ew3ad5cf3